Puthari, the Kodagu traditional festival, is one of the region’s most celebrated harvest festivals, marking the end of the rice harvest. This festival is a time for family reunions, traditional feasts, and rituals honoring the earth. The community comes together to offer prayers to the gods for a bountiful harvest and celebrate with folk dances, music, and traditional performances.
